Nader R. Ammar is a scholar working on Environmental Engineering, Aerospace Engineering and Energy Engineering and Power Technology. According to data from OpenAlex, Nader R. Ammar has authored 32 papers receiving a total of 861 ind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Environmental Engineering, 9 papers in Aerospace Engineering and 9 papers in Energy Engineering and Power Technology. Recurrent topics in Nader R. Ammar's work include Maritime Transport Emissions and Efficiency (29 papers), Hybrid Renewable Energy Systems (9 papers) and Vehicle emissions and performance (8 papers). Nader R. Ammar is often cited by papers focused on Maritime Transport Emissions and Efficiency (29 papers), Hybrid Renewable Energy Systems (9 papers) and Vehicle emissions and performance (8 papers). Nader R. Ammar collaborates with scholars based in Egypt, Saudi Arabia and Kuwait. Nader R. Ammar's co-authors include Ibrahim S. Seddiek, Mohamed M. Elgohary, Ahmed Salih Mohammed, Wael M. El‐Maghlany and Ahmed G. Elkafas and has published in prestigious journals such as SHILAP Revista de lepidopterología, Environmental Science and Pollution Research and Transportation Research Part D Transport and Environment.
